一种数据监控方法与监控平台技术

技术编号:23399767 阅读:15 留言:0更新日期:2020-02-22 12:04
本申请提供了一种数据监控方法与监控平台,涉及监控技术领域。该数据监控方法应用于监控平台,监控平台与多个业务端通信连接,且监控平台包括数据存储层,数据存储层包括Hbase以及OpenTSDB,首先在接收到业务端发送的数据时,将数据存储至Hbase,然后周期性地利用OpenTSDB对Hbase中存储的目标业务端的数据进行的调用,并对调用的数据进行排序与整合处理,最后将处理后的数据发送至目标业务端。本申请提供的数据监控方法与监控平台具有通过一个独立的监控平台实现对多个业务端的监控,节省了资源的优点。

A data monitoring method and monitoring platform

【技术实现步骤摘要】
一种数据监控方法与监控平台
本申请涉及监控
,具体而言,涉及一种数据监控方法与监控平台。
技术介绍
目前,在企业的监控系统上,企业的每个部门均需要各自定制一套独立的监控系统,以进行各自部门的硬件及数据的监控。由于每个部门的监控系统均独立开来,因此从数据源采集、监控规则配置、监控输出都需要定制开发,适用性差,资源浪费较大。综上所述,目前企业没有一套独立的监控系统,导致资源浪费较大。
技术实现思路
本申请的目的在于提供一种数据监控方法与监控凭条,以解决现有技术中企业没有一套独立的监控系统,导致资源浪费较大的问题。为了解决上述问题,本申请是这样实现的:一方面,本专利技术实施例提供了一种数据监控方法,应用于监控平台,所述监控平台与多个业务端通信连接,且所述监控平台包括数据存储层,所述数据存储层包括Hbase以及OpenTSDB,所述方法包括:接收到所述业务端发送的数据时,将所述数据存储至所述Hbase;周期性地利用OpenTSDB对所述Hbase中存储的目标业务端的数据进行的调用,并对调用的数据进行排序与整合处理;将处理后的数据发送至所述目标业务端。进一步地,所述数据存储层还包括HDFS,所述将所述数据存储至所述Hbase的步骤包括:利用所述HDFS所述数据分类存储至所述Hbase中;在所述将所述数据存储至所述Hbase的步骤之后,所述方法还包括:利用所述OpenTSDB按预设定的时间周期对所述Hbase中存储的数据进行压缩。进一步地,所述Hbase的存储空间包括多行与多列,所述利用所述OpenTSDB按预设定的时间周期对所述Hbase中存储的数据进行压缩的步骤之前,所述方法包括:将所述数据按不同列存储至所述Hbase;所述利用所述OpenTSDB按预设定的时间周期对所述Hbase中存储的数据进行压缩的步骤包括:当经过一个时间周期时,利用HDFS将所述时间周期内所有列的数据进行压缩,并组成一行数据。进一步地,在所述接收到所述业务端发送的数据的步骤之后,所述方法还包括:通过预设定的规则对所述数据进行筛选,当所述数据不满足所述预设定的规则时,生成告警信息并输出。进一步地,所述通过预设定的规则对所述数据进行筛选,当所述数据不满足所述预设定的规则时,生成告警信息并输出的步骤包括:将所述数据与预设定的阈值进行比较,当所述数据的值大于所述阈值时,生成告警信息并输出。进一步地,在所述将处理后的数据发送至所述目标业务端的步骤之前,所述方法还包括:当接收到多个业务端发送的数据处理指令时,按消息队列解耦对所述多个业务端发送的数据处理指令进行处理。另一方面,本专利技术实施例提供了一种监控平台,所述监控平台与多个业务端通信连接,且所述监控平台包括数据收发层与数据存储层,所述数据存储层包括Hbase组件以及OpenTSDB组件;所述数据收发层用于接收所述业务端发送的数据;所述Hbase组件用于存储所述数据;所述OpenTSDB组件用于对所述Hbase组件中存储的目标业务端的数据进行的调用,并对调用的数据进行排序与整合处理;所述数据收发层还用于将处理后的数据发送至所述目标业务端。进一步地,数据存储层还包括HDFS组件;所述HDFS组件用于将所述数据分类存储至所述Hbase中;所述HDFS还用于按预设定的时间周期对所述Hbase中存储的数据进行压缩。进一步地,所述HDFS组件用于将所述时间周期内所有列的数据进行压缩,并组成一行数据。进一步地,所述数据收发层用于接收接口数据、文本日志数据、爬虫数据以及业务端及其性能数据。相对于现有技术,本申请具有以下有益效果:本专利技术实施例提供了一种数据监控方法与监控平台,该数据监控方法应用于监控平台,监控平台与多个业务端通信连接,且监控平台包括数据存储层,数据存储层包括Hbase以及OpenTSDB,首先在接收到业务端发送的数据时,将数据存储至Hbase,然后周期性地利用OpenTSDB对Hbase中存储的目标业务端的数据进行的调用,并对调用的数据进行排序与整合处理,最后将处理后的数据发送至目标业务端。一方面,通过本申请提供的监控平台,能够实现对多个业务端的数据处理,通过一个独立的监控平台实现对多个业务端的监控,节省了资源。另一方面,利用Hbase及OpenTSDB进行数据表的存储,抛弃了传统关系型数据的存储架构,利用Hbase的可拓展性,实现了大量数据存储的效果。为使本申请的上述目的、特征和优点能更明显易懂,下文特举较佳实施例,并配合所附附图,作详细说明如下。附图说明为了更清楚地说明本申请实施例的技术方案,下面将对实施例中所需要使用的附图作简单地介绍,应当理解,以下附图仅示出了本申请的某些实施例,因此不应被看作是对范围的限定,对于本领域普通技术人员来讲,在不付出创造性劳动的前提下,还可以根据这些附图获得其它相关的附图。图1为本申请实施例提供第一种数据监控方法的流程图。图2为本申请实施例提供第二种数据监控方法的流程图。图3为本申请实施例提供图2中S103-a1的子步骤的流程图。图4为本申请实施例提供第三种数据监控方法的流程图。图5为本申请实施例提供监控平台与业务端的交互示意图。图6为本申请实施例提供监控平台的模块示意图。图中:110-监控平台;120-业务端。具体实施方式为使本申请实施例的目的、技术方案和优点更加清楚,下面将结合本申请实施例中的附图,对本申请实施例中的技术方案进行清楚、完整地描述,显然,所描述的实施例是本申请一部分实施例,而不是全部的实施例。通常在此处附图中描述和示出的本申请实施例的组件可以以各种不同的配置来布置和设计。因此,以下对在附图中提供的本申请的实施例的详细描述并非旨在限制要求保护的本申请的范围,而是仅仅表示本申请的选定实施例。基于本申请中的实施例,本领域普通技术人员在没有作出创造性劳动前提下所获得的所有其他实施例,都属于本申请保护的范围。应注意到:相似的标号和字母在下面的附图中表示类似项,因此,一旦某一项在一个附图中被定义,则在随后的附图中不需要对其进行进一步定义和解释。同时,在本申请的描述中,术语“第一”、“第二”等仅用于区分描述,而不能理解为指示或暗示相对重要性。需要说明的是,在本文中,诸如第一和第二等之类的关系术语仅仅用来将一个实体或者操作与另一个实体或操作区分开来,而不一定要求或者暗示这些实体或操作之间存在任何这种实际的关系或者顺序。而且,术语“包括”、“包含”或者其任何其他变体意在涵盖非排他性的包含,从而使得包括一系列要素的过程、方法、物品或者设备不仅包括那些要素,而且还包括没有明确列出的其他要素,或者是还包括为这种过程、方法、物品或者设备所固有的要素。在没有更多限制的情况下,由语句“包括一个……”限定的要素本文档来自技高网...

【技术保护点】
1.一种数据监控方法,其特征在于,应用于监控平台,所述监控平台与多个业务端通信连接,且所述监控平台包括数据存储层,所述数据存储层包括Hbase以及OpenTSDB,所述方法包括:/n接收到所述业务端发送的数据时,将所述数据存储至所述Hbase;/n周期性地利用OpenTSDB对所述Hbase中存储的目标业务端的数据进行的调用,并对调用的数据进行排序与整合处理;/n将处理后的数据发送至所述目标业务端。/n

【技术特征摘要】
1.一种数据监控方法,其特征在于,应用于监控平台,所述监控平台与多个业务端通信连接,且所述监控平台包括数据存储层,所述数据存储层包括Hbase以及OpenTSDB,所述方法包括:
接收到所述业务端发送的数据时,将所述数据存储至所述Hbase;
周期性地利用OpenTSDB对所述Hbase中存储的目标业务端的数据进行的调用,并对调用的数据进行排序与整合处理;
将处理后的数据发送至所述目标业务端。


2.如权利要求1所述的数据监控方法,其特征在于,所述数据存储层还包括HDFS,所述将所述数据存储至所述Hbase的步骤包括:
利用所述HDFS所述数据分类存储至所述Hbase中;
在所述将所述数据存储至所述Hbase的步骤之后,所述方法还包括:
利用所述OpenTSDB按预设定的时间周期对所述Hbase中存储的数据进行压缩。


3.如权利要求2所述的数据监控方法,其特征在于,所述Hbase的存储空间包括多行与多列,所述利用所述HDFS按预设定的时间周期对所述Hbase中存储的数据进行压缩的步骤之前,所述方法包括:
将所述数据按不同列存储至所述Hbase;
所述利用所述OpenTSDB按预设定的时间周期对所述Hbase中存储的数据进行压缩的步骤包括:
当经过一个时间周期时,利用OpenTSDB将所述时间周期内所有列的数据进行压缩,并组成一行数据。


4.如权利要求1所述的数据监控方法,其特征在于,在所述接收到所述业务端发送的数据的步骤之后,所述方法还包括:
通过预设定的规则对所述数据进行筛选,当所述数据不满足所述预设定的规则时,生成告警信息并输出。


5...

【专利技术属性】
技术研发人员:何凯彬
申请(专利权)人:广州力挚网络科技有限公司
类型:发明
国别省市:广东;44

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1